Tesla's storage solutions aren't just theoretical. Their Victoria Big Battery project in Australia:
Now replicating this success in Japan's Shiga Prefecture, Tesla's 548MWh project will become the country's largest storage facility by 2027 - crucial for an island nation targeting 33% renewable energy.
